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.
ContestId |
Name |
Phase |
Frozen |
Duration (Seconds) |
Relative Time |
Start Time |
|---|---|---|---|---|---|---|
| 2184 | Codeforces Round 1072 (Div. 3) | FINISHED | False | 8100 | 8177123 | Jan. 12, 2026, 2:35 p.m. |
Solved |
Index |
Name |
Type |
Tags |
Community Tag |
Rating |
|---|---|---|---|---|---|---|
| ( 9343 ) | D | Unfair Game | PROGRAMMING | combinatorics dp math |
Bob is tired of losing to Alice and, to ensure he doesn't lose again, decided to choose a game in which he is guaranteed to win. Bob has thought of a number from (1) to (n), where it is known that (n = 2^d) for some non-negative integer (d). Initially, Alice knows whether the chosen number is even or not. In one move, Alice can either halve the number or subtract (1). Alice can only halve the number if the current number is even. Only Alice takes turns. After her move, Alice receives a response from Bob: either (-1), which means the number has become (0) and Alice has won, or a non-negative integer (x). If we denote the current number as (a), then for (x) the following conditions hold simultaneously: (a) is divisible by (2^x). (a) is not divisible by (2^{x+1}). For example, if (a=5), then (x=0), since (5) is divisible by (2^0=1) and not divisible by (2^1=2), and if (a=12), then (x=2), since (12) is divisible by (2^2=4) and not divisible by (2^3=8). It can be shown that for any integer (a > 0), there exists a unique such (x). Bob is still afraid that Alice will win, so the game will have no more than (k) moves. Additionally, Bob wants to maximize his chances of winning, so he wants to play as many games as possible. Given (n) and (k), calculate the number of initial numbers from (1) to (n) such that Alice, playing optimally, cannot win in no more than (k) moves. The first line contains an integer (t) ((1 \le t \le 10^4)) — the number of test cases. The only line of each test case contains (2) integers (n) and (k) ((1 \le n, k \le 10^9)) — the limit on the chosen number and the maximum number of Alice's moves, respectively. It is guaranteed that (n = 2^d) for some non-negative integer (d). For each test case, output the number of integers from (1) to (n) such that Alice, playing optimally, can |
| Codeforces Round 1072 (Div. 3) Editorial |
Submission Id |
Author(s) |
Index |
Submitted |
Verdict |
Language |
Test Set |
Tests Passed |
Time taken (ms) |
Memory Consumed (bytes) |
Tags |
Rating |
|---|---|---|---|---|---|---|---|---|---|---|---|
| 357708655 | samyak2004 | D | Jan. 13, 2026, 1:45 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 31 | 0 | ||
| 357716493 | Gauss28 | D | Jan. 13, 2026, 2:42 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 31 | 102400 | ||
| 357682634 | nab_002 | D | Jan. 13, 2026, 10:12 a.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 31 | 102400 | ||
| 357653690 | anonymous_17 | D | Jan. 13, 2026, 4:55 a.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 31 | 102400 | ||
| 357686179 | m.pb2 | D | Jan. 13, 2026, 10:45 a.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 31 | 7372800 | ||
| 357765101 | Goolu | D | Jan. 13, 2026, 9:38 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 46 | 0 | ||
| 357762916 | TMSniper | D | Jan. 13, 2026, 8:52 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 46 | 0 | ||
| 357760139 | HopefulSpecialist | D | Jan. 13, 2026, 8:08 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 46 | 0 | ||
| 357748347 | Divy_8745 | D | Jan. 13, 2026, 6:20 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 46 | 0 | ||
| 357747215 | Dobby_Code | D | Jan. 13, 2026, 6:13 p.m. | OK | C++17 (GCC 7-32) | TESTS | 19 | 46 | 0 | ||
| 357730529 | Toronto.Tokyo | D | Jan. 13, 2026, 4:29 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 31 | 102400 | ||
| 357728116 | aviate | D | Jan. 13, 2026, 4:12 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 31 | 102400 | ||
| 357696248 | Jahid__Noob | D | Jan. 13, 2026, 12:10 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 31 | 102400 | ||
| 357784198 | not_from_iit_d | D | Jan. 14, 2026, 5:39 a.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357783273 | sadnessnsorrow | D | Jan. 14, 2026, 5:26 a.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357781977 | Jteh | D | Jan. 14, 2026, 5:07 a.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357764883 | Panther | D | Jan. 13, 2026, 9:33 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357752052 | yojit.k | D | Jan. 13, 2026, 6:47 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357747377 | valor_1 | D | Jan. 13, 2026, 6:14 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357744237 | sonthaliyap | D | Jan. 13, 2026, 5:55 p.m. | OK | C++20 (GCC 13-64) | TESTS | 19 | 46 | 0 | ||
| 357775859 | CN_Hoang | D | Jan. 14, 2026, 3:21 a.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 0 | ||
| 357695406 | 4ankit_raj9 | D | Jan. 13, 2026, 12:03 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 0 | ||
| 357689260 | bsn666 | D | Jan. 13, 2026, 11:11 a.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 0 | ||
| 357656465 | 1618s3 | D | Jan. 13, 2026, 5:32 a.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 0 | ||
| 357768594 | thekmman | D | Jan. 13, 2026, 11:44 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 102400 | ||
| 357758606 | becastal | D | Jan. 13, 2026, 7:48 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 102400 | ||
| 357757555 | Hany_Osama | D | Jan. 13, 2026, 7:36 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 102400 | ||
| 357749448 | hexhunter06 | D | Jan. 13, 2026, 6:27 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 102400 | ||
| 357714948 | lazyflash99 | D | Jan. 13, 2026, 2:29 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 102400 | ||
| 357710389 | MakaNehith14 | D | Jan. 13, 2026, 1:57 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 19 | 31 | 102400 | ||
| 357719241 | ruban | D | Jan. 13, 2026, 3:04 p.m. | OK | FPC | TESTS | 19 | 93 | 9830400 | ||
| 357784485 | Leeeee | D | Jan. 14, 2026, 5:43 a.m. | OK | Go | TESTS | 19 | 46 | 512000 | ||
| 357675648 | 567jiong | D | Jan. 13, 2026, 9:13 a.m. | OK | Go | TESTS | 19 | 62 | 819200 | ||
| 357674301 | 567jiong | D | Jan. 13, 2026, 9 a.m. | OK | Go | TESTS | 19 | 62 | 819200 | ||
| 357656620 | LittleGopher | D | Jan. 13, 2026, 5:33 a.m. | OK | Go | TESTS | 19 | 156 | 4403200 | ||
| 357743600 | VivirAstucia | D | Jan. 13, 2026, 5:51 p.m. | OK | Haskell | TESTS | 19 | 171 | 102400 | ||
| 357786768 | _ameysawant_ | D | Jan. 14, 2026, 6:10 a.m. | OK | Java 21 | TESTS | 19 | 203 | 1638400 | ||
| 357766832 | pcmeena511 | D | Jan. 13, 2026, 10:29 p.m. | OK | Java 21 | TESTS | 19 | 234 | 409600 | ||
| 357778201 | cpp10 | D | Jan. 14, 2026, 4:03 a.m. | OK | Java 21 | TESTS | 19 | 234 | 614400 | ||
| 357701364 | madhanirahul92 | D | Jan. 13, 2026, 12:52 p.m. | OK | Java 21 | TESTS | 19 | 234 | 716800 | ||
| 357685653 | UlianaKhodaeva | D | Jan. 13, 2026, 10:41 a.m. | OK | Java 21 | TESTS | 19 | 250 | 716800 | ||
| 357718118 | SathvikGoud | D | Jan. 13, 2026, 2:55 p.m. | OK | Java 21 | TESTS | 19 | 250 | 2048000 | ||
| 357778131 | cpp10 | D | Jan. 14, 2026, 4:02 a.m. | OK | Java 21 | TESTS | 19 | 265 | 1024000 | ||
| 357710122 | sulabhambule | D | Jan. 13, 2026, 1:55 p.m. | OK | Java 21 | TESTS | 19 | 265 | 1024000 | ||
| 357754161 | Aaditya01Sehgal | D | Jan. 13, 2026, 7:05 p.m. | OK | Java 21 | TESTS | 19 | 296 | 1638400 | ||
| 357685887 | jaxxnitt | D | Jan. 13, 2026, 10:43 a.m. | OK | Java 21 | TESTS | 19 | 312 | 1331200 | ||
| 357746162 | abhi... | D | Jan. 13, 2026, 6:06 p.m. | OK | Java 8 | TESTS | 19 | 125 | 0 | ||
| 357725921 | Picklzes | D | Jan. 13, 2026, 3:57 p.m. | OK | Java 8 | TESTS | 19 | 375 | 0 | ||
| 357765453 | arvindf232 | D | Jan. 13, 2026, 9:48 p.m. | OK | Kotlin 2.2 | TESTS | 19 | 218 | 24678400 | ||
| 357673920 | chennaiMetroOP | D | Jan. 13, 2026, 8:56 a.m. | OK | PyPy 3 | TESTS | 19 | 953 | 7680000 | ||
| 357675887 | chennaiMetroOP | D | Jan. 13, 2026, 9:15 a.m. | OK | PyPy 3 | TESTS | 19 | 984 | 9113600 | ||
| 357709941 | Ayushman_123 | D | Jan. 13, 2026, 1:54 p.m. | OK | PyPy 3 | TESTS | 19 | 984 | 9728000 | ||
| 357702949 | Eigen_Vector | D | Jan. 13, 2026, 1:03 p.m. | OK | PyPy 3-64 | TESTS | 19 | 109 | 3891200 | ||
| 357701739 | Eigen_Vector | D | Jan. 13, 2026, 12:54 p.m. | OK | PyPy 3-64 | TESTS | 19 | 109 | 3993600 | ||
| 357707341 | bhargav_kikani | D | Jan. 13, 2026, 1:36 p.m. | OK | PyPy 3-64 | TESTS | 19 | 125 | 3072000 | ||
| 357747401 | the_anchor_being | D | Jan. 13, 2026, 6:14 p.m. | OK | PyPy 3-64 | TESTS | 19 | 125 | 3276800 | ||
| 357707548 | bhargav_kikani | D | Jan. 13, 2026, 1:38 p.m. | OK | PyPy 3-64 | TESTS | 19 | 125 | 4096000 | ||
| 357703411 | Eigen_Vector | D | Jan. 13, 2026, 1:07 p.m. | OK | PyPy 3-64 | TESTS | 19 | 125 | 4198400 | ||
| 357767264 | zuba37 | D | Jan. 13, 2026, 10:45 p.m. | OK | PyPy 3-64 | TESTS | 19 | 125 | 4403200 | ||
| 357687978 | jagannathpisharody | D | Jan. 13, 2026, 11 a.m. | OK | PyPy 3-64 | TESTS | 19 | 140 | 4608000 | ||
| 357686929 | gardengnome | D | Jan. 13, 2026, 10:52 a.m. | OK | PyPy 3-64 | TESTS | 19 | 140 | 4608000 | ||
| 357697489 | HumbleRobo | D | Jan. 13, 2026, 12:21 p.m. | OK | PyPy 3-64 | TESTS | 19 | 140 | 5017600 | ||
| 357722489 | 22pa1a05f9 | D | Jan. 13, 2026, 3:31 p.m. | OK | Python 3 | TESTS | 19 | 312 | 2969600 | ||
| 357703192 | Eigen_Vector | D | Jan. 13, 2026, 1:05 p.m. | OK | Python 3 | TESTS | 19 | 515 | 307200 | ||
| 357739548 | joneswilliamaa | D | Jan. 13, 2026, 5:26 p.m. | OK | Python 3 | TESTS | 19 | 562 | 307200 | ||
| 357777593 | hundunlilun1 | D | Jan. 14, 2026, 3:52 a.m. | OK | Python 3 | TESTS | 19 | 578 | 102400 | ||
| 357753890 | kushagra2468 | D | Jan. 13, 2026, 7:03 p.m. | OK | Python 3 | TESTS | 19 | 593 | 102400 | ||
| 357703021 | Eigen_Vector | D | Jan. 13, 2026, 1:04 p.m. | OK | Python 3 | TESTS | 19 | 734 | 204800 | ||
| 357756420 | rakshit__modi | D | Jan. 13, 2026, 7:25 p.m. | OK | Python 3 | TESTS | 19 | 812 | 204800 | ||
| 357700339 | Eigen_Vector | D | Jan. 13, 2026, 12:44 p.m. | OK | Python 3 | TESTS | 19 | 859 | 204800 | ||
| 357673349 | MihailLoginov | D | Jan. 13, 2026, 8:52 a.m. | OK | Python 3 | TESTS | 19 | 875 | 409600 | ||
| 357731058 | GUAIKATTO | D | Jan. 13, 2026, 4:32 p.m. | OK | Rust 2024 | TESTS | 19 | 46 | 13414400 | ||
| 357709063 | Yoda1122 | D | Jan. 13, 2026, 1:48 p.m. | OK | Rust 2024 | TESTS | 19 | 93 | 0 | ||
| 357773907 | hirose2020 | D | Jan. 14, 2026, 2:38 a.m. | OK | Rust 2024 | TESTS | 19 | 109 | 11776000 | ||
| 357773608 | _JG_ | D | Jan. 14, 2026, 2:30 a.m. | OK | Rust 2024 | TESTS | 19 | 125 | 0 | ||
| 357773572 | _JG_ | D | Jan. 14, 2026, 2:29 a.m. | OK | Rust 2024 | TESTS | 19 | 156 | 11776000 |
Back to search problems